Transaction 106a5be25c0aae618676eb394c705128d66ffc4b95c4f95fed56c499e621f37a
1 Input
1 Output
-
106a5be25c0aae618676eb394c705128d66ffc4b95c4f95fed56c499e621f37a:0
- value
- 99288
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3f5d7ecb820eba208009010fadf5568020454f9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MnLu3oPeg1o35ZSRNfz14nYVX5L6aNMza